Quick summary
Over the last 12–18 months the AI market shifted from “general-purpose LLMs” to practical, task-focused AI agents. Businesses can now assemble lightweight agents that combine a company’s documents, CRM data, and automation tools with a foundation model. These agents use ret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) and connectors to answer questions, draft outreach, automate workflows, and produce on-demand reports — with much less manual engineering than earlier approaches.
Why this matters for business
- Faster value: Agents turn existing data (knowledge bases, CRM, spreadsheets) into usable workflows quickly — you get business impact sooner than building custom software.
- Better sales and service: Agents can draft personalized outreach, summarize account health, and give reps step-by-step next actions.
- Smarter reporting: Instead of one-off BI dashboards, agents answer natural-language queries and generate concise, explainable reports on demand.
- Lower operational cost: Replacing repetitive human tasks with supervised agents reduces time-to-response and frees teams for higher-value work.
- Safer rollout: Modern tools let you set guardrails, source attribution, and human-in-the-loop checks to reduce risk.

Quick checklist to get started
- Pick one measurable use case (e.g., shorten lead response time, automate weekly sales reports).
- Identify the data sources needed and check access/security.
- Run a short pilot with human oversight.
- Define KPIs (time saved, conversion lift, report accuracy).
- Iterate, then scale.
